A significant MAG-5.8 earthquake struck in the North Pacific Ocean 73 kilometer from Petropavlovsk-Kamchatsky, Russia in the night of Tuesday August 18th, 2026. Around 260 thousand people have been exposed to shaking.

Earthquake Summary
This earthquake hit under water in the North Pacific Ocean, 22 kilometers (14 mi) off the coast of Russia, 73 kilometer east of Petropavlovsk-Kamchatsky in Kamchatka. The center of this earthquake had a quite shallow depth of 55 km. Shallow earthquakes usually have a larger impact than earthquakes deep in the earth.

Minimal impact predicted
Based on scientific estimates by the US Geographic Survey (USGS), the risk of high fatalities for this earthquake is classified at level GREEN (low). They expect an 90% likelyhood of between 0 and 1 fatalities.
The USGS classifies the economic impact of this earthquake at level GREEN (low). They expect an 90% likelyhood of between 0 and 1 million US Dollars in economic damage and impact.
Roughly 260 thousand people exposed to shaking
This earthquake may have been felt by around 260 thousand people. That is the expected population size of the area exposed to a level of shaking of II or higher on the Modified Mercalli scale according to the USGS.
An estimated 227,900 people were exposed to level IV. At this level, light shaking and likely no damage can be expected. All exposure to shaking was within the borders of Russia .

Risk of aftershocks?
This earthquake did not have any significant foreshocks nor aftershocks occurring within 100km (62 mi) of its epicenter.
Aftershocks are usually at least 1 order of magnitude less strong than main shocks. The more time passes, the smaller the chance and likely strength of any potential aftershocks.
It's always adviced to be cautious of the risk of a larger shock following any significant earthquake, however this risk is fairly small. There is a roughly 94 percent change that no larger main shock will follow in the days following this earthquake.

Earthquakes of this strength are very common in the region. This is the strongest earthquake to hit since June 20th, 2026, when a 5.8 magnitude earthquake hit 87 km (54 mi) further south-east. An even stronger magnitude 8.8 earthquake struck on July 29th, 2025.
In total, 56 earthquakes with a magnitude of 5.8 or higher have been registered within 300km (186 mi) of this epicenter in the past 10 years. This comes down to an average of once every 2 months.
Low tsunami risk
Based on early data it appears this earthquake was not strong enough (lower than MAG-6.5) to be likely to cause destructive tsunami's. However this earthquake appeared to have hit at a shallow depth under sea, so stay cautious and monitor advice from local authorities.
